Durban - A Durban teacher pleaded guilty to 230 child pornography charges in the Durban Regional Court on Thursday.

Colin Chapman, who was a theatre manager at Durban Boys High School, and did relief teaching at a number of Durban schools, pleaded guilty to charges of possession of child pornography, the creation of child pornography, the exploitation of children and the grooming of children.

Magistrate Wendolyn Robinson sentenced him to three years imprisonment as part of a plea agreement that was reached between the State and Chapman.

She also ordered that his name be entered on the sexual offenders register and he be declared unfit to work with children.

He was also ordered to pay R100 000 to a charity and attend a sex offenders rehabilitation programme.

While Chapman did not physically abuse his two victims aged 15 and 17 years, he groomed them persuading them to take pictures, videos of themselves partially naked and on occasion performing acts of self gratification.

He would pay them for the pictures and video clips.

Up until Chapman, 50, pleaded he could not be named.

The court heard that Chapman had had a previous conviction in 2003 for the indecent assault of a minor for which he was handed a five year suspended sentence.

Prosecutor Jerome Gnanapragas said that while the offences were serious, the fact that Chapman had pleaded guilty had saved the two teenagers from having to face the embarrassing and trying situation of testifying in open court.
